Philips Selecon Recalls Four- and Eight-Leaf Barndoors for Rama Luminaire Stage Lights Due to Impact Hazard
Description
This recall involves 6-inch barndoors with four and eight leaves. The recalled barndoors are used on Rama Fresnel and Rama PC stage lights. The barndoors are made of hinged, rectangular, black metal flaps/leaves attached to a moveable, round, plastic collar. The collar is six inches in diameter. Four-leaf barndoors are part number 20BDSF12 and eight-leaf barndoors are part number 20BDSF128. The part numbers are only on the invoice for the product.
Injuries / Consequence
Philips Selecon has received three reports of barndoors used outside the United States detaching. No injuries were reported. No incidents or injuries have been reported in the U.S.
Remedy
Consumers should immediately stop using the recalled barndoors and contact Philips Selecon for a free safety cable and installation instructions.
